Please enable JavaScript.
Coggle requires JavaScript to display documents.
กระบวนการทำงานและโครงสร้างของเว็บไซต์ - Coggle Diagram
กระบวนการทำงานและโครงสร้างของเว็บไซต์
คำศัพท์พื้นฐานต่างๆ ที่เกี่ยวข้องกับเว็บไซต์
เว็บเพจ (web page)
ข้อมูลที่สร้างขึ้นในรูปแบบต่างๆ ไม่ว่าจะเป็นข้อความ รูปภาพ เสียง ภาพเคลื่อนไหว โดยจัดเก็บอยู่ในรูปแบบไฟล์ HTML (Hyper Text Markup Language) ซึ่งไฟล์ HTML 1 ไฟล์ก็คือเว็บเพจ 1 หน้านั่นเอง
เว็บไซต์ (web site)
เว็บเพจหลายๆ หน้ารวมกัน โดยมีการกำหนดเว็บเพจหน้าแรก เรียกว่า โฮมเพจ ที่เป็นช่องทางเว็บเพจทั้งหมดภายในเว็บไซต์นั้น
โฮมเพจ (home page)
เอกสารของเว็บเพจ ซึ่งเมื่อเข้าสู่เว็บแล้วจะปรากฏเป็นหน้าแรกสุด ซึ่งผู้สร้างจะต้องสร้างให้โดดเด่น น่าสนใจ เพื่อให้เข้าไปยังเว็บเพจหน้าต่อๆ ไป
เว็บบราวเซอร์ (web browser)
โปรแกรมสำหรับเรียกดูเว็บเพจ โดยตัวเว็บบราวเซอร์จะเข้าใจในภาษา HTML ซึ่งเป็นภาษามาตรฐานของเว็บบราวเซอร์ เช่น Internet Explorer, Mozilla Firefox, Google Chrome, เป็นต้น
เว็บเซิร์ฟเวอร์ (web server)
ที่เก็บเว็บเพจ เมื่อผู้ใช้ต้องการเปิดดูเว็บเพจที่อยู่ในเครื่องเซิร์ฟเวอร์ โดยเว็บบราวเซอร์จะทำการติดต่อกับเซิร์ฟเวอร์ที่เก็บเว็บไซต์นั้น เพื่อให้มีการโอนย้ายข้อมูลมาแสดงที่เครื่องของผู้ใช้
ความสำคัญที่ต้องมีเว็บไซต์
เป็นอีกช่องทางหนึ่งในการประกาศ โฆษณา และเป็นตลาดซื้อขายสินค้า
สร้างความน่าเชื่อถือให้กับองค์กร บริษัท
โปรโมทองค์กร ให้เป็นที่รู้จัก
ประโยชน์ของเว็บไซต์
ช่วยส่งเสริมศักยภาพการแข่งขันในด้านธุรกิจ
ช่วยโฆษณาบริษัทหรือองค์กร และช่วยเผยแพร่ข้อมูลข่าวสารและบริการต่างๆ ให้เป็นที่รู้จักอย่างแพร่หลาย
ช่วยขายสินค้าทางอินเตอร์เน็ต สร้างรายได้โดยไม่ต้องมีหน้าร้านหรือสำนักงาน
สามารถให้บริการต่างๆ ของธุรกิจหรือองค์กรแบบออนไลน์ เป็นการอำนวยความสะดวกแก่ลูกค้า
ช่วยลดค่าใช้จ่ายในการโฆษณาประชาสัมพันธ์ธุรกิจ
การทำงานของเว็บไซต์
เครื่องคอมพิวเตอร์ของเราพิมพ์ที่อยู่เว็บไซต์ที่จะเปิดดูและร้องขอไปยังเครื่องเซิร์ฟเวอร์
เว็บเซิร์ฟเวอร์ค้นหาไฟล์ เว็บไซต์ที่เครื่องผู้ใช้ร้องขอ
ไฟล์ที่เก็บเว็บไซต์ที่เว็บเซิร์ฟเวอร์
เว็บเซิร์ฟเวอร์ส่งข้อมูลไฟล์เว็บเพจไปให้เครื่องผู้ใช้เปิดแสดงภาพผ่านบราวเซอร์
โครงสร้างเว็บไซต์
เว็บที่มีโครงสร้างแบบเรียงลำดับ (sequential struture)
โครงสร้างแบบนี้เหมาะกับเว็บไซต์ที่มีขนาดเล็ก เนื้อหาไม่ซับซ้อนใช้การลิงค์ไปทีละหน้า ทิศทางของการเข้าสู่เนื้อหา (Navigation) ภายในเว็บจะเป็นการดำเนินเรื่องในลักษณะเส้นตรง โดยมีปุ่มเดินหน้า-ถอยหลัง
เว็บที่มีโครงสร้างแบบลำดับขั้น (hierarchical structure)
แบ่งเนื้อหาออกเป็นส่วนต่างๆ และมีรายละเอียดย่อยๆ ในแต่ละส่วนลดหลั่นกันมา ลักษณะเด่นเฉพาะของเว็บประเภทนี้คือ การมีจุดเริ่มต้นที่จุดร่วมจุดเดียว นั่นคือ โฮมเพจ (Homepage) และเชื่อมโยงไปสู่เนื้อหาในลักษณะเป็นลำดับจากบนลงล่าง
เว็บที่มีโครงสร้างแบบตาราง (grid structure)
การออกแบบเพิ่มความยืดหยุ่นให้แก่การเข้าสู่เนื้อหาของผู้ใช้ โดยเพิ่มการเชื่อมโยงซึ่งกัน การเข้าสู่เนื้อหาของผู้ใช้จะไม่เป็นลักษณะเชิงเส้นตรง ผู้ใช้สามารถเปลี่ยนทิศทางการเข้าสู่เนื้อหาของตนเองได้
เว็บที่มีโครงสร้างแบบใยแมงมุม (web structure)
โครงสร้างประเภทนี้จะมีความยืดหยุ่นมากที่สุด ทุกหน้าในเว็บสามารถจะเชื่อมโยงไปถึงกันได้หมด เป็นการสร้างรูปแบบการเข้าสู่เนื้อหาที่เป็นอิสระ
ส่วนประกอบของหน้าเว็บไซต์
ส่วนหัวของส่วนของเนื้อหา (Page Body)
ส่วนของเนื้อหา (Page Body)
ส่วนท้ายของหน้า (Page Footer)
รูปแบบของเว็บไซต์
สเตติกเว็บไซต์ (Static Website)
ร้องขอเว็บเพจ
ส่งเว็บเพจกลับไปยัง Web Browser
ไดนามิกเว็บไซต์ (Dynamic Website)
ร้องขอเว็บเพจ
เรียกซอฟต์แวร์โปรแกรมภาษาขึ้นมาประมวลผลไฟล์โปรแกรม
ติดต่อกับฐานข้อมูล (ถ้ามี)
ส่งเว็บเพจกลับไปยัง Web Browser
เว็บความหมาย (Semantic Website)
เป็นเทคโนโลยีที่ใช้ในการจัดเก็บและนำเสนอเนื้อหาแบบมีโครงสร้าง รวมถึงสามารถที่จะวิเคราะห์ จำแนก หรือจัดแบ่งได้ว่าข้อมูลที่ปรากฏนั้นมีความสัมพันธ์ กับข้อมูลอื่นๆ ในแต่ละระดับอย่างไร
โปรแกรมที่ใช้สร้างเว็บไซต์
โปรแกรมที่ใช้เขียน Code เว็บเพจด้วยภาษา HTML
HTML ซึ่งย่อมาจาก Hyper Text Markup Language เป็นโปรแกรมภาษาประเภทหนึ่งสำหรับแสดงข้อความต่างๆ ในรูปของข้อความ รูปภาพ หรือภาพเคลื่อนไหว ฯลฯ และสามารถเชื่อมโยงข้อมูลไปยังเอกสารอื่นได้
โปรแกรมสำเร็จรูปสำหรับสร้างเว็บไซต์
สร้างเว็บไซต์ด้วยโปรแกรมสำเร็จรูป Dreamweaver
สร้างเว็บไซต์ด้วยโปรแกรมระบบ CMS (Content Management System)
ขั้นตอนการสร้างเว็บไซต์
ขั้นตอนที่ 1 กำหนดโครงร่างของเว็บไซต์
ขั้นตอนที่ 2 กำหนดการเชื่อมโยงระหว่างเว็บเพจ
ขั้นตอนที่ 3 ออกแบบเว็บเพจแต่ละหน้าภายในเว็บไซต์
ขั้นตอนที่ 4 สร้างเว็บเพจแต่ละหน้า
ทำการเขียนโปรแกรมภาษา HTML หรือโปรแกรมสำเร็จรูปสำหรับสร้างเว็บไซต์
ขั้นตอนที่ 5 ลงทะเบียนขอพื้นที่เว็บไซต์ฟรี
ขั้นตอนที่ 6 อัพโหลดเว็บไซต์
ด้วยโปรแกรม Cute FTP, File, Zilla เพื่อให้คนทั่วโลกสามารถดูเว็บไซต์ของเราผ่านเครือข่ายอินเทอร์เน็ต